A Disintegrin And Metalloproteinase (ADAM) are peptidases which cleave off extracellular portions of transmembrane proteins. ADAM inhibitors are used in anti-cancer therapy. ADAM family members are numbered. ADAM10 cleaves ephrin. ADAM17 processes the tumor necrosis factor-α. ADAM33 is implicated in asthma. The images at the left and at the right correspond to one representative ADAM, i.e. the crystal structure of bovine A Disintegrin And Metalloproteinase 10 (2ao7).
